Coach Frank says:
Jacob comes off an impressive summer and fall having amassed a lot of playing time on a veteran team entering the season with high expectations. He quickly gained the trust and respect of teammates because he is a high IQ guard who takes care of the basketball and gets the ball to his scorers, he doesn’t turn it over and he is a tough, high energy defender. He also happens to be the son of a high school coach! Jacob demonstrated his impact in his first varsity game for Green Run in the Boo Williams Fall League when he had 8 points, 6 assists and four steals. He has proven since that impressive debut the ability to contribute consistently at the varsity level. Jacob not only brings a court awareness beyond his freshman years and skillful guard play but he has great poise and confidence. He really handles the ball well, has great vision and is an excellent passer. Jacob can break down his defender and get into the lane and score, can knock down the jumper and also can hit the three pointer. He had several multiple three point basket games over the summer for Team Loaded AAU. An athletic and quick footed guard, Jacob defends his position and is an active and harassing defender. Jacob has a solid grasp of the fundamentals and also a skillful approach to the game rarely seen in a player so young. His upside is exciting and he will establish himself among the areas better guards as his high school career progresses. It’s obvious watching him play that he has command of the responsibilities of his position and the skill and athleticism to execute at a high level on a program with championship hopes.
